That's right. Thank to Bjørn-Helge who help me.

You must enable swapaccount in the kernel as shown here: 
https://unix.stackexchange.com/questions/531480/what-does-swapaccount-1-in-grub-cmdline-linux-default-do
By default, this is apparently not necessary to explicit this option for RHEL7, 
but I'm on Debian.

Now everything works fine with this cgroup.conf configuration:

CgroupAutomount=yes
ConstrainCores=yes
ConstrainSwapSpace=yes
